So the Rockies are seriously considering keeping him up and making him the starting 3B. Prior to drafts last year he was the hot NL minor leaguer. He batted .298 20 122 A+ in 2011 583 PA (9.1 and 8.1 k and bb%). In 2012 he batted .285 12 56 in AA. Similar PA and 10.1 and 6.8 k and bb%.
He has had a solid ST showing some power and is a good defender.
